... Read morePropagating plants from cuttings is a rewarding and popular gardening practice that allows you to create new plants from existing ones. Ideal for both novice and experienced gardeners, the process can be as simple as taking a healthy cutting, placing it in water or soil, and providing the necessary care to encourage root development. Cuban oregano, a favorite among culinary enthusiasts, not only offers vibrant flavor but also thrives with minimal effort in propagation. Beyond this herb, many plants can be easily propagated through cuttings, such as basil, mint, and succulents. Each type of plant may require specific conditions like light, temperature, and humidity for optimal growth, so it's essential to research the needs of your chosen species.
